In 'Arcadia', the ending is a masterful blend of tragedy and hope. The protagonist, after years of battling internal demons and external foes, finally uncovers the truth about the mystical realm—it was a test of humanity’s resilience all along. The final act sees them sacrificing their own chance at eternal peace to restore balance, merging the fractured world of Arcadia with reality. The last pages linger on a quiet sunrise, symbolizing rebirth.

Secondary characters get poignant closures too. The rogue scholar, once cynical, finds faith in the ruins of the old world, while the vengeful antagonist dissolves into the wind, his purpose fulfilled. The prose shifts from frantic to meditative, leaving readers with a bittersweet aftertaste. It’s the kind of ending that doesn’t tie every thread neatly but makes the loose ends feel intentional, like life itself.

'Arcadia' closes with a twist—the 'paradise' was a prison all along. The protagonist breaks the cycle, freeing everyone but losing their memories. The last scene shows them smiling at a stranger (their former lover), feeling déjà vu. It’s open-ended but satisfying. Minor arcs resolve cleverly: the betrayer becomes a gardener, symbolizing growth. The prose is minimalist, letting the emotional weight carry the ending. No grand speeches, just a quiet nod to second chances.

Why does 'Arcadia' have multiple timelines?

4 Answers2025-06-15 09:02:57
The multiple timelines in 'Arcadia' aren't just a narrative gimmick—they're the backbone of its world-building. The story unfolds across eras to explore how choices ripple through time, showing how a single decision in the past can fracture reality into divergent paths. One timeline might depict a utopian society where technology and nature harmonize, while another reveals a dystopian wasteland, emphasizing the fragility of progress. The timelines also deepen character arcs. A hero in one era could be a villain in another, challenging our assumptions about fate and morality. The interplay between these realities creates tension, as characters from different timelines occasionally cross paths, their clashing ideologies sparking conflict. It’s a brilliant way to showcase how history isn’t linear but a tapestry of 'what ifs,' making 'Arcadia' feel expansive and philosophically rich.
